Event narrative
Severe (D2) drought condition persisted over almost all of Custer County through the end of January. Moderate (D1) drought continued over far southeastern portions of the county through the end of the month. The cooperative observer at Callaway 8WSW reported 0.22 inches of precipitation for January. The cooperative observer at Broken Bow 2W reported 0.12 inches of precipitation for January. This was 0.20 inches below the normal of 0.32 inches. At the Broken Bow Airport, 0.02 inches of precipitation fell in January. This was 0.33 inches below the normal of 0.35 inches.
Wider weather episode
Moderate (D1) drought conditions expanded somewhat into portions of southwestern Nebraska in January. Across the remainder of western and north central Nebraska, drought conditions remained unchanged during the month of January.
